- Solr reload core 3 and above, an error is returned, and V2 API implementation for reloading an individual core. It is the admin core that reload other cores. 0. Solr will start loading the new core, and continue to serve requests from the old core until the new core is completely loaded. To reload it I decided to simply restart Tomcat using the Windows Services managament console. sh supports multiple cores via different endpoints. http://localhost:8983/solr/admin/cores?action=RELOAD&core=foobar Jun 28, 2019 · While it is initializing, the old core will continue to accept requests. The format is a comma-separated list of node_names, such as localhost:8983_solr, localhost:8984_solr, localhost:8985_solr. That said, for a simpler self-hosted setup, I would recommend using Upstart to start and stop Solr, if your system has Upstart available. I added a core, so I changed solr. Mar 16, 2018 · I noticed that on solr reload the thread count increases a lot there by resulting in increased latencies. Is this correct? Sep 28, 2021 · The entries in each core. properties file are vital for Solr to function correctly. 3, this class was required so that the core functionality could be re-used multiple times. I am updating the Synonym. Jun 9, 2017 · The RELOAD action loads a new core from the configuration of an existing, registered Solr core. One solution is doing a solr Nov 4, 2020 · The RELOAD action loads a new core from the configuration of an existing, registered Solr core. 0 to 4. How do I stop Solr cores being deleted by Tomcat restart. Feb 5, 2018 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and Is it possible to reload Solr configuration without setting up Multicore or restarting the servlet container? I would like to tweak some <analyzer> chains with the analysis tab in the admin, Oct 23, 2014 · I have a Solr setup with multiple solr collections/Cores. 8. Altering these entries by specifying property. The procedure is slightly different and with these API you can reload the configuration on the entire Cluster with only one API call. The recommended way is to dynamically create cores/collections using the APIs. txt file dynamically but Solr server is not getting the latest changes from Synonym. Jun 17, 2021 · The RELOAD action loads a new core from the configuration of an existing, registered Solr core. You can monitor the progress of the reload process in the Solr admin interface. One for the production System and one the staging. How do I verify is core reload was successful or not? For Solr 6 and later Platform. Solr will reload the core, which will effectively rebuild the index for that core. Once it has finished, all new request will go to the "new" core, and the "old" core will be unloaded. So I read about reload process and came to know that while reloading. Cores may be anywhere in the tree with the exception that cores may not be defined under an existing core. store. While the new core is initializing, the existing one will continue to handle requests. This means that you can reload the new configurations and schema files with ZERO down time. Good examples are using a different Apache Solr core for each language or of course a separate core for each website. The RELOAD action loads a new core from the configuration of an existing, registered Solr core. When multi-core support was added to Solr way back in version 1. xml , restart the core and run the data import utility. I have a Solr slave that is running in Tomcat. In Solr 4. Add role, remove role, set cluster property. Jun 21, 2021 · Reload, rename, delete, and unload a core. Jun 9, 2017 · Allows defining the nodes to spread the new collection across. Mar 11, 2014 · Solr has the feature of reloading core. Oct 30, 2024 · It is possible to use multiple cores on one single Apache Solr instance. xml in order for Solr to know about them. Sep 28, 2021 · In older versions of Solr, cores had to be predefined as <core> tags in solr. The MIGRATE command is used to migrate all documents having a given routing key to another collection. 1) Solr creates a new core internally and then assigns this core same name as the old core. Therefore, I just want the new core to show up and assumed a RELOAD would suffice even if it isn't a RELOAD, but only a LOAD to be precise. Aug 14, 2014 · The core itself cannot reload itself. Feb 23, 2018 · Solr: Reloading core from a request handler. Append /_introspect to any valid v2 API path and the API specification will be returned in JSON format. Oct 31, 2024 · Learn how to efficiently rebuild your Solr index by using the core reload feature. When the new Solr core is ready, it takes over and the old core is unloaded. Upload and download blobs and metadata. Jan 10, 2016 · At Websolr, we use a combination of a custom init. How to Uninitialize solr core when not used. d script plus Monit to start Solr and ensure that it stays running. apache. Solr cores are configured by placing a file named core. Nov 8, 2012 · You will need to modify the <cores> entry in the solr. name=value is an expert-level option and should only be used if you have a thorough understanding of the consequences. txt file dynamically? So I have to reload/restart the Solr core programatically so how can I do that? thanks in advance SolrCore got its name because it represents the "core" of Solr -- one index and everything needed to make it work. Cores and endpoints are defined separately, with endpoints referencing cores. Sep 15, 2016 · You have to reload your cores after giving it a new schema. xml. For more information please refer to the Apache Solr documentation for "Core" explanation. 2, the above behaviour still holds, but is buggy, and clients should use the RELOAD action instead. Each core may have its own configuration or share a configuration. home. LockObtainFailedException: Index locked for write for core Solr Collection API are indicated for SolrCloud and the configuration reload will be spread in the whole cluster. Replace name with core in your query as: /solr/admin/cores?action=RELOAD&**core**=yourcorename For example . Oct 31, 2024 · Click on the "Reload" button for the core you want to rebuild. Once the reload process is complete, the Solr index for the core will be rebuilt and ready for use. timeout parameter. There are no a-priori limits to the depth of the tree, nor are there limits to the number of cores that can be defined. So, this is done outside the scope of the core itself. May 23, 2017 · I am using SolrJ for indexing my data. txt file, my previous question is how to update synonym. Is this correct? Feb 1, 2012 · I have 2 cores. I want to reload a core and verify if the core reload was successful or not. So I read about reload process and came to know that while reloading 1) Solr creates a new core internally and then assigns this core same name as the old core. The new API (POST /v2/cores/coreName/reload is analogous to the v1 /admin/cores?action=RELOAD command. And this is to get zero-down-time. . This is because internally it creates another instance of the core, and still serve requests from old core, until the new core is ready then it switches to the new core. Nov 15, 2016 · Basically I am writing a Powershell script that will create a new core if one doesn't exist, update the schema. It is best illustrated with an example. Oct 1, 2019 · The RELOAD action loads a new core from the configuration of an existing, registered Solr core. 1. Jul 2, 2015 · @Oliver: Because I already copied and pasted an existing core, I don't need to CREATE the core anymore (see section My current way of adding Solr cores). I copy with incron and scp the new generated synonymes to the solr server and restart the tomcat to reload it. This step-by-step guide will teach you everything you need to know to optimize your Solr search performance. properties in a sub-directory under solr. Now, however, Solr supports automatic discovery of cores and they no longer need to be explicitly defined. Below is the example that comes with the Solr distribution. lucene. Perform overseer operation, rejoin leader election. xml file that is in the root of where your Solr instance is running and add at least one <core> entry. The source collection will continue to have the same data as-is but it will start re-routing write requests to the target collection for the number of seconds specified by the forward. After restarting Tomcat I keep getting the following exception: org. As far as I know Solr Collection API are available at least from Solr 4. If not provided, the CREATE operation will create shard-replica spread across all live Solr nodes. Overriding entries can result in unusable collections. That is, the I noticed that on solr reload the thread count increases a lot there by resulting in increased latencies. mwvd rcgnhf zwjir olcc wbdnm kbsma bxhvxm dzvxlkei pmhse cjenmo